The late Gulshan Kumar, was renowned for producing many popular devotional songs back in the early to mid 90’s, before he sadly passed away. But his legacy will be continued by his son Bhushan Kumar, who has successfully released tracks such as ‘Gajanan’ (for Ganpati) and ‘Maiya Teri Jai Jaikaar’ (for Mata Rani).

Reported in The Times of India, Bhushan has released a special track today called “‘Dhaak Baja Kanshor Baja’, as part of the Navratri Durga Puja, which allows one to immerse themselves in bhakti but at the same time bringing it up-to-date offering celebratory vibes, which caters for the younger audience. For vocalists he has none other than the singing sensation Shreya Ghoshal. The song has been written��by Priyo Chatterjee and��composed by Jeet Gannguli.

Gannguli who has produced Bollywood songs mainly, feels blessed to have been able to work on these tracks.��”They will always be priceless for me. ‘Dhaak Baja Kanshor Baja’s’ orchestration is amazing. Dhaak and kanshor are considered shubho (auspicious), so we have used these words to express devotion. This is Shreya’s first non-film solo for Maa Durga. She has a melodious voice and has done complete justice to the song,” said Gannguli.
